KEY INGREDIENTS IN REFRESHING CREAMY FRESH LEMONADE
Before diving into the step-by-step guide, let’s take a look at the star players that make this lemonade so irresistible. Each ingredient plays a key role in building layers of flavor and texture, ensuring that every glass is a harmonious blend of tangy, sweet, and creamy notes.
- Fresh Lemons
These are the heart of the recipe, providing bright acidity and natural citrus oils. Freshly squeezed lemon juice delivers an unmistakable zing that canned concentrates simply can’t match. Straining out seeds and excess pulp ensures a silky texture.
- Granulated Sugar
This sweet granule is essential for balancing the lemons’ tartness. As you stir it into warm or room-temperature lemon juice, it dissolves completely, lending a smooth sweetness that complements the citrus without overpowering it.
- Cold Water
This diluting component transforms concentrated lemon-sugar syrup into a refreshing beverage. Using chilled water helps keep the temperature down from the start, so your lemonade stays perfectly cool.
- Heavy Cream
Here’s the twist: heavy cream brings a luscious, velvety mouthfeel that turns ordinary lemonade into a dessert-style treat. It mellows the acidity, adding a rich, smooth layer that feels indulgent and luxurious.
- Vanilla Extract
Just a hint of vanilla deepens the cream’s natural sweetness and rounds out the sharp edges of the lemon. Its warm aroma elevates the drink, creating a subtle complexity you’ll notice sip after sip.
- Ice Cubes
Beyond chilling the drink, ice cubes help maintain that frosty temperature without diluting flavors too quickly. Add them to the glass just before serving for maximum refreshment.
- Lemon Slices and Mint Leaves
These garnishes add visual appeal and an extra burst of aroma. A thin lemon wheel perched on the rim and a few vibrant mint leaves tucked into the glass make each serving look as gorgeous as it tastes.
HOW TO MAKE REFRESHING CREAMY FRESH LEMONADE
Crafting this delightful creamy lemonade is straightforward and incredibly satisfying. In just a few simple steps, you’ll transform fresh ingredients into a smooth, tangy-sweet drink that’s perfect for any occasion.
1. Begin by juicing the lemons to extract fresh lemon juice. Aim for about one cup of juice, then strain it through a fine sieve to remove any seeds or pulp. This step ensures a silky-smooth texture without unexpected bits.
2. In a large pitcher, combine the fresh lemon juice and granulated sugar. Stir well until the sugar is completely dissolved. This creates a sweet lemon concentrate that forms the foundation of your lemonade.
3. Slowly pour in the cold water, stirring continuously to blend the mixture evenly. Adding the water gradually prevents separation and maintains a uniform flavor throughout the pitcher.
4. In a separate small bowl, whisk the heavy cream with the vanilla extract until they are fully incorporated. This creates a creamy vanilla blend that will infuse richness into the lemonade.
5. Carefully pour the cream mixture into the lemon-water base. Stir gently to combine, being careful not to overmix. You’ll notice the lemonade turning a smooth, pale hue as the cream envelopes the citrus elements.
6. Prepare your serving glasses by filling them with ice cubes. This ensures each pour stays cold and refreshing right to the last drop.
7. Pour the creamy lemonade over the ice in each glass, watching as it cascades into a frosty, luxurious beverage.
8. Garnish with thin lemon slices and sprigs of mint leaves for an extra layer of fragrance and a festive look.
9. Serve immediately and enjoy the unique interplay of creamy richness and zesty tang in every sip.

HOW TO STORE REFRESHING CREAMY FRESH LEMONADE
Keeping your creamy lemonade tasting fresh and vibrant over time requires a bit of care. Because of the heavy cream, it’s important to store it properly to maintain its velvety texture and prevent any separation. Follow these tips to enjoy leftovers without sacrificing flavor or consistency.
- Refrigerate in an Airtight Pitcher: Transfer the lemonade into a glass or BPA-free pitcher with a tight-fitting lid. This minimizes air exposure, preserving both aroma and creaminess. Store it on a middle shelf in the fridge, where temperatures remain consistent.
- Use a Glass Container: Glass retains cold temperatures better than plastic and won’t absorb flavors or odors. If you have a sealable glass jar or bottle, pour the leftover lemonade into it before refrigerating.
- Stir Before Serving: Over time, some separation may occur, with cream settling at the top. Before you pour a second helping, give the batch a gentle stir to reincorporate all elements evenly.
- Consume Within 24 Hours: To experience the lemonade at its peak—bright, smooth, and rich—enjoy any leftovers within one day. Beyond that, flavors can dull and texture may weaken, so it’s best to make fresh batches for longer-term enjoyment.
